Guess where I was last week! If you follow SpittoonExtra you would of course know it was Vinoteca. This marvellous little place has another accolade - Time Out's Best Wine Bar. You won't be able to get a table for weeks now!

Time Out
"Based on the enotecas of Italy, Vinoteca is a small, plain room with wood floors, white walls, plus shelves showing off every bottle you can drink.The 200-bin list champions underrated regions of Spain, France and Italy, and is kind on the wallet. Wine by the glass ranges from about £2.95 to £8. The shock is that the food is so good; that’s down to chef Carol Craddock, who worked at Bibendum. The menu features dishes such as crisp fillet of sea bass on pickled cucumbers, fennel and ginger, with mint and a lovely tamarind and chilli dressing. Vinoteca has a licence for off-sales too, so if a tipple takes your fancy, simply take it away for more."
